In New Jersey, the transition between humid summers and cold winters means your heating and cooling systems are frequently in operation. This constant use circulates air, drawing in dust, pollen, pet dander, and other airborne particles into your ductwork. Our cleaning process is designed to remove these accumulated contaminants. We use specialized rotary brushes and high-efficiency vacuum systems to dislodge and extract debris from every part of your duct system, from the main trunk lines to individual vents.

How often do house air ducts need to be cleaned in New Jersey?

In New Jersey, we generally recommend duct cleaning every 2-3 years. The changing seasons, with pollen in spring and dust in drier periods, contribute to buildup. Homes with pets or residents with allergies may benefit from more frequent cleaning to maintain air quality.

What is the typical process for duct cleaning?

Our cleaning process begins with sealing off your HVAC system and containing the work area. We then use specialized tools to dislodge debris from your ducts and a powerful vacuum to extract it. Finally, we clean registers and ensure all components are reassembled properly.

Does New Jersey's climate affect duct cleaning needs?

New Jersey's distinct seasons, with humid summers and dry winters, can impact duct cleanliness. Humidity can encourage microbial growth, while dry periods increase dust circulation. Regular cleaning helps manage these seasonal environmental factors for better indoor air.
